Assault cases classified as B Misdemeanor across 51 New York counties have a 79.2% average dismissal rate and a 20.7% average conviction rate, based on 13,199 public court records.

Charge class reflects the severity classification at arrest. B Misdemeanor is one of multiple classifications for Assault. Dismissal rate includes judicial dismissals and cases dismissed in the interest of justice. Data from New York DCJS Pretrial Release Data. Last updated: March 2026

What B Misdemeanor Means

B Misdemeanor is a misdemeanor classification under New York Penal Law. Misdemeanors carry potential county jail sentences of up to one year. Assault charges classified as B Misdemeanor are less severe than felony classifications but can still result in a criminal record.

Across 51 counties, Assault B Misdemeanor cases have an average dismissal rate of 79.2%. Outcomes vary by county due to differences in prosecutorial practices, plea bargaining customs, and caseload pressures.

Assault B Misdemeanor outcomes by county.

County Cases Dismissal Rate Conviction Rate
New York 3,149 83.4% 16.5%
Kings 2,634 92.5% 7.4%
Bronx 2,268 87.4% 12.6%
Queens 1,810 86.5% 13.5%
Nassau 519 62.2% 37.4%
Westchester 465 53.2% 45.7%
Richmond 368 76.0% 24.0%
Orange 243 61.5% 38.1%
Niagara 242 47.6% 51.6%
Suffolk 190 52.7% 47.3%
Erie 142 60.5% 38.8%
Onondaga 91 49.3% 49.3%
Fulton 73 9.1% 89.4%
Saratoga 72 39.3% 60.7%
Oneida 71 40.7% 59.3%
Albany 69 43.3% 56.7%
Dutchess 58 46.3% 53.7%
Monroe 56 50.0% 50.0%
Clinton 53 21.2% 76.9%
Schenectady 51 44.4% 55.6%
Steuben 46 20.0% 77.1%
Ulster 43 54.1% 45.9%
Chemung 40 57.6% 42.4%
Rensselaer 39 47.1% 52.9%
Rockland 38 75.7% 21.6%
Oswego 37 20.0% 80.0%
Cattaraugus 32 42.9% 57.1%
Ontario 31 36.7% 63.3%
Tompkins 30 56.5% 43.5%
Chautauqua 27 48.0% 52.0%
Broome 27 36.4% 63.6%
Otsego 21 42.9% 57.1%
Genesee 17 7.1% 92.9%
Cayuga 17 13.3% 80.0%
St. Lawrence 15 50.0% 50.0%
Montgomery 12 22.2% 77.8%
Madison 12 16.7% 83.3%
Jefferson 10 20.0% 70.0%
Franklin 10 25.0% 75.0%
Cortland 8 33.3% 66.7%
Chenango 8 25.0% 75.0%
Livingston 7 28.6% 71.4%
Sullivan 6 40.0% 60.0%
Schoharie 6 16.7% 83.3%
Putnam 6 33.3% 66.7%
Warren 5 25.0% 75.0%
Seneca 5 25.0% 75.0%
Greene 5 50.0% 50.0%
Essex 5 33.3% 66.7%
Delaware 5 75.0% 25.0%
Columbia 5 66.7% 33.3%
